CO2 and Climate Monitoring in Offices
Stuffy meeting rooms, hot and cold spots across the floor, no clear answer on whether ventilation is adequate. A CO2 level of 1,000 ppm is a widely used ventilation guideline. Place CO2 sensors and thermo-hygrometers in offices and meeting rooms, and answer with numbers instead of impressions.
Listed companies in Japan describe workplace-environment measures such as ventilation and comfortable-office initiatives in the human-capital section of their annual securities reports, in integrated reports, and in responses to the METI Health and Productivity Management survey. Few publish the readings themselves, but a continuous record that shows when, in which room, and at what level backs up those statements and lets you answer disclosure teams and hygiene committees immediately.

Restaurant Kitchens, Dining Floors, and Refrigeration
Kitchens can approach 40°C in summer, and Japan's workplace heat-stroke prevention rules (mandatory since June 2025) apply to restaurant kitchens as well. With supported sensors you can collect data on kitchen heat, dining-floor comfort, and refrigerator/freezer temperatures all at once — replacing handwritten temperature checklists with continuous records.

Can Sustira be used for strict temperature control of pharmaceuticals or vaccines?
No. Please refrain from using Sustira where laws, regulations, or guidelines require certified or calibrated thermometers, temperature data loggers, or dedicated monitoring systems — such as storage of prescription pharmaceuticals, vaccines, blood products, or clinical trial specimens (e.g., under GDP guidelines), measurements used for legal certification, or ultra-low-temperature storage. The sensors used with Sustira are general-purpose IoT sensors and do not provide official certification or calibration. Use Sustira to understand room conditions and as supplementary reference records alongside dedicated systems.
